Output ebc869b6414c8bbe601a0071c6d5949f78703581528348039d5d1df9f2956553:0

value
1483755502
script pubkey
OP_0 OP_PUSHBYTES_20 dbbc83723802530fd2a9940813ff2f73ac97a26e
address
bc1qmw7gxu3cqffsl54fjsyp8le0wwkf0gnw7pw9ec
transaction
ebc869b6414c8bbe601a0071c6d5949f78703581528348039d5d1df9f2956553
spent
true